Taylor Knapp Will Race For Yamalube/Westby Racing In MotoAmerica Superstock 1000 Championship This Weekend At Barber Motorsports Park

Tulsa, OK - June 9, 2016 – With team rider Josh Day at home in Orlando, Florida, recuperating from injuries sustained in a crash during MotoAmerica Superstock 1000 practice this past Saturday at Road America in Wisconsin, veteran rider and current MotoAmerica Superstock 1000 competitor Taylor Knapp will race the Yamalube/Westby Racing Yamaha YZF-R1 Superstock 1000 machine this weekend at round 6 of the 2016 MotoAmerica AMA/FIM North American Motorcycle Road Racing Championship. The announcement was made by Tryg Westby, team owner of Yamalube/Westby Racing.
 
Taylor, who is currently ranked sixth in the Superstock 1000 Championship points standings, will race at Barber for Yamalube/Westby Racing with his trademark #44 competition number emblazoned on the team’s iconic gold-and-black R1.
 
In 2015, aboard a TOBC racing Yamaha R1, Taylor notched one race victory and reached the podium in 13 of the 18 Superstock 1000 races on the season, including a pair of podium finishes at Barber last year, on his way to being runner-up in the 2015 MotoAmerica Superstock Championship. So far this season, the Michigander has notched two podium finishes--a second-place result at Road Atlanta and a third at VIRginia International Raceway.
 
Chuck Giacchetto, team manager of Yamalube/Westby Racing commented, “After Josh got injured at Road America last weekend, our team had to make one of our most difficult decisions to date. With Barber coming up in less than a week, we owed it to our loyal sponsors and team partners to have our bike on track. We love and respect Josh so much that we didn’t want to do a disservice to him. We spoke to Taylor last week, and the timing was right for him to be able to race for us at Barber. He’s an excellent rider and a really good person, so we’re pleased to be able to put this deal together. It’s a positive step for both Taylor and for us.”
 
Taylor commented, “I’m really excited to join Yamalube/Westby Racing for this weekend’s MotoAmerica event at Barber Motorsports. They’re one of the best-run teams in motorcycle road racing, and it’s going to be great to work with them. Hopefully, I can give them the results that they deserve, and I’m certainly looking forward to racing that beautiful gold-and-black Yamalube/Westby Racing R1. It’s an honor to have my #44 on that bike and continue the legacy that Dane and Tryg began.”
 
Taylor and the Yamalube/Westby Racing team will be on track at Barber beginning this Friday, June 10, starting with Superbike/Superstock 1000 practice at 11:50 AM CST. Superbike Superpole (Qualifying) begins on Saturday at 2:00 PM CST. Superbike Race 1 will go green on Sunday at 12:30 PM CST, and Superbike Race 2 is later on Sunday at 4:00 PM CST.

About Yamalube
Located in Kennesaw, GA, under Yamaha Motor Corporation, U.S.A.’s (YMUS) Customer Support Group (CSG), Yamalube formulates the only oil “built around” the unique demands, operating characteristics, and applications of the various motorsports engines produced. In 1967, after more than a decade of racing and countless wins, Yamaha set off to conquer a new arena--racing oil. Collaborating with Yamaha engine designers, Yamalube's global oil engineers formulate each oil from scratch, to be engine- and application-specific.
